Why Learn Spanish with a Mexican Focus?
Spanish is spoken by over 480 million native speakers worldwide, with Mexico being the country with the largest Spanish-speaking population. Learning easy Spanish Mexico style comes with unique benefits:
- Widespread Use: Mexican Spanish is prevalent not only in Mexico but also throughout the United States and parts of Central America.
- Cultural Richness: Mexico has a rich cultural heritage, and learning its variant of Spanish allows deeper connection to its traditions, music, food, and history.
- Business and Travel: Mexico is a major player in international trade and a popular tourist destination, making proficiency in Mexican Spanish valuable for professionals and travelers alike.
- Distinct Vocabulary and Pronunciation: Mexican Spanish has unique expressions, slang, and pronunciation that differ from other Spanish dialects, enhancing your overall language skills.

Key Components of Easy Spanish Mexico Learning
Mastering easy Spanish Mexico requires attention to several language components. Below, we break down essential areas to focus on:
Pronunciation and Accent
Mexican Spanish pronunciation is distinct, characterized by clear vowel sounds and soft consonants. Key points include:
- Rolling the “r” sound moderately compared to other dialects.
- Pronouncing the “ll” and “y” similarly, often as a “y” sound.
- Soft “s” sounds at the end of words, unlike the aspirated “h” in some Caribbean dialects.
Common Vocabulary and Phrases
Familiarizing yourself with everyday words and phrases used in Mexico can boost your conversational skills quickly. Examples include:
- ¡Qué onda! : A casual greeting meaning “What’s up?”
- Chido: Slang for “cool” or “awesome.”
- ¿Mande?: Polite way of saying “Pardon?” or “What did you say?”
Grammar Nuances
While Spanish grammar is generally consistent, Mexican Spanish sometimes favors informal usage and specific verb forms, such as:
- Using “ustedes” instead of “vosotros” for the plural “you.”
- Frequent use of diminutives like “-ito” or “-ita” to express affection or smallness (e.g., “cafecito” for “little coffee”).
Effective Strategies to Learn Easy Spanish Mexico
Adopting the right strategies accelerates language acquisition. Here are actionable tips to master easy Spanish Mexico efficiently:
Immerse Yourself with Mexican Media
Consume Mexican films, music, and television to get accustomed to the accent and cultural context. Examples include:
- Watching telenovelas or Mexican movies on streaming platforms.
- Listening to popular Mexican artists like Luis Miguel or Natalia Lafourcade.
- Following Mexican news outlets and podcasts.

Understanding Regional Variations
Mexico has regional dialects with slight variations. To manage this:
- Focus initially on standard Mexican Spanish used in media and education.
- Gradually expose yourself to regional accents once comfortable.

Avoiding Literal Translation
Translating directly from your native language can lead to awkward phrases. Instead:
- Think in Spanish as much as possible.
- Learn phrases as whole units rather than word-by-word.
